Common Residential & Commercial Roofing Scams in Lavon

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ators

🚫

Storm Chaser Fraud

Out-of-town crews swarm after hail or wind storms, offer 'special deals' on new roofs, take a deposit, then do shoddy work or disappear.

🚫

Deposit and Dash

Contractor demands 50%+ upfront cash, buys cheap materials, starts work minimally, then vanishes or claims excuses to get more money.

🚫

Exaggerated Damage Upsell

Scammer 'inspects' and claims extensive hidden damage requiring full replacement, when only minor repairs are needed.

🚫

Phantom Warranty Scam

Promises lifetime warranties on cheap materials that fail quickly, then goes out of business or ignores claims.

How to Verify a Professional

1

Insurance

Request certificates of general liability insurance (at least $1M) and workers' compensation. Call the insurer directly using the info on the certificate to verify it's active and covers the job scope. Uninsured roofers put you at risk for accidents.

2

Licensing

Texas doesn't require a state license for roofing, but check business registration on the Texas Secretary of State website. Contact Lavon City Hall or Collin County offices to confirm local business permits and compliance. Look for membership in local roofing associations as a good sign.

3

References

Ask for 3-5 recent references from Lavon or nearby Collin County jobs of similar size. Call them to verify work quality, timeliness, cleanup, and if they'd rehire. Check online reviews on BBB, Google, but balance with personal calls.

Protection FAQs

Do roofers need a license in Lavon, TX?

Texas doesn't mandate a state roofing license, but verify business registration via Texas Secretary of State. Check with Lavon City Hall for local permits. Reputable pros will provide this info gladly.

How important is insurance for roofing contractors?

Critical! Roofing accidents happen—ladders, heights, tools. Demand liability and workers' comp certificates, then call to confirm. You're liable otherwise.

Should I pay a deposit for roofing work?

Yes, but only 10-30% max, tied to starting work. Never full payment upfront or in cash. Stage payments by progress.

What about door-to-door roofers after a storm?

Very risky in storm-prone Collin County. They often lack local ties. Get bids from established Lavon providers instead.

How many quotes should I get for roofing?

At least 3 from different contractors. Compare apples-to-apples on materials, scope, and price. Avoid the lowest bid if it seems too good.

Can I check reviews for roofers?

Yes, use BBB, Angi, Google for Lavon-specific feedback. But always verify with personal reference calls—reviews can be manipulated.

Do trustworthy roofers pull permits?

Absolutely. Permits ensure code compliance and inspections. Ask to see them; check status with Lavon building department.
